COLUMBIA, S.C., Dec. 16 (UPI) -- South Carolina Gov. Nikki Haley endorsed Mitt Romney for president Friday, giving him crucial support for the Palmetto State's upcoming primary in January.

"Today is the day that I am throwing all of my support behind Mitt Romney for president," Haley said.

Romney, a former governor of Massachusetts, said in a statement it was "an honor" to be endorsed by Haley, The Hill reported. Romney endorsed Haley when she ran for governor in 2010.

The Republican South Carolina governor said she wanted to endorse a candidate who would improve "jobs, the economy and spending."

"What I want is someone who is not part of the chaos that is Washington. What I wanted was someone who knew what it was like to turn broken companies around," she said.

"He's very much become a great candidate, just like Ronald Reagan did in that in his first run he learned a lot as a candidate," Haley said. "I don't think this is about being a candidate anymore; he spends a lot of time thinking about our country and how to get it back on track."

Haley added she believes Romney can beat President Barack Obama in a general election.

"Governor Romney is the one candidate that President Obama consistently tries to hit and get out of the way," Haley said. "That lets me know he's scared of him. It also lets me know Governor Romney's got a good fight in him and that's the one President Obama doesn't want to have to go against."
